当前位置:首页 » 安卓系统 » android第三方类库

android第三方类库

发布时间: 2022-08-14 21:26:28

‘壹’ 安卓导入的第三方类库修改不了,应该怎么做

导入的类库如果是通过Jar包,或是通过Gradle compile进去,那么是不能修改的。你可以用导入Mole的方式导入,你就可以进行自定义修改了。

‘贰’ Android阅读pdf的第三方类库,该怎么处理

我认为第三方开源库只能算是一种工具而不能算是一种手段,即不能一味的把开发过程理解为“开源库搜索和使用”过程,那样的话辛辛苦苦学习的开发和编程知识真的不能对自己的进步起到任何作用,一个项目完工也许自己写的代码还没几行,而且大部分可能是非常基础和没有技术含量的。正确的使用方法应当是将开源库作为为自己应用服务的工具,使用时知其然,使用后尝试知其所以然,博采众长方能成一家气候,用代码来创造而不是来制造,这一点非常关键。

‘叁’ Android Studio 怎么添加第三方库

转载本人也刚刚开始尝试做android app的开发,听说android studio是Google支持的android 应用开发工具,所以想应该肯定比Eclipse好用吧,反正以前没有java开发经验,索性就从android studio开始学,以前一直是做.net的开发,最近使用了Eclipse,Android Studio之后发现Visual studio.net正式太好用了,不得不说微软的开发工具做的比谁都好。下面是我在使用Android Studio应用第三类库刚开始的时候走了不少弯路,所以写下来给和我一样的初学者,分享一下


导入*.jar包

新建好了Android项目,添加一个第三方已经打包好的jar文件进你项目,下面就已添加一个odata4j的一个包


这样就完成了jar文件添加


打开App目录下有个build.gradle文件应该项目结构文件,上述的动作只是为了在在文件下添加


dependencies {


compile files('libs/android-support-v13.jar')


compile files('libs/odata4j-0.7.0-clientbundle.jar')


}


‘肆’ 如何向android studio中导入第三方类库

下面分两种情况介绍一下如何导入第三方类库。

1、对于jar的类库,非常简单,只要在项目根目录下新建一个libs目录,然后把jar复制进去,在jar上点击右键,选择Add as library,即可完成依赖的添加。

2、对于github等网站上下载的源码类库,是无法通过这种方式添加的。首先把git clone下来的整个文件夹放入项目根目录下,这里以我自己的开发包为例,我的开发包名字是ShunixDevKit,里面有一个lib目录才是真正的类库,那么我们要做的就是手动在settings.gradle里面添加:

include ':ShunixDevKit:lib'
注意,gradle使用:作为路径分隔符。这样Android Studio就知道了我们的类库放在哪里,当然这样还是不够的,要让项目能使用类库,我们还需要添加这个类库作为项目的依赖,选择File->Project Structure,然后选中主mole的名称,点击dependencies,添加:ShunixDevKit:lib就可以了,gradle的build就能成功。

以上就是添加第三方类库作为依赖的过程。这里需要注意一下的地方就是,导入的类库根目录下的gradlew文件一定要可执行,否则Android Studio会提示错误,而且根据错误信息很难找出来这个错误,希望对大家有帮助。

‘伍’ android studio怎么添加第三方类库

如果是本地引用将jar包放入程序根目录下的libs中,然后右键点击jar选择add as Library
如果是依赖配置则在 gradle 文件中配置依赖来解决,比如:
compile 'com.xx.xx:ProjectName:Version'
更详细可参考:http://www.cnblogs.com/neozhu/p/3458759.html

‘陆’ android studio2.0怎么导入第三方类库

1打开android
studio2.0软件
选择
File
-->
new
-->
Import
Mole...
(注意不是
Import
Project
这个是导入项目
又会启动一个窗口)
2选择右边的按钮
然后我们看到弹出了选择文件的对话框
我们在电脑指定目录下找到我们需要导入的第三方类库
然后点击OK
3我们来看看是否已经成功导入了第三方类库,按快捷键
Ctrl+Shift+Alt+S键或选择左上角的Flie-->project
Structure...
弹出一个对话
我们选择
右上角的”Dependcies“就可以看到下面我们添加的第三方类库了

‘柒’ android studio 怎么导入第三方类库

Android Studio导入第三方类库的方法:

第一、导入*.jar包

新建好了Android项目,添加一个第三方已经打包好的jar文件进你项目,下面就已添加一个odata4j的一个包

但是编译肯定还是会错误的

还必须在项目Httpzoid目录下添加一个build.gradle的这个文件,内容如下

buildscript {

repositories {

mavenCentral()

}

dependencies {

classpath 'com.android.tools.build:gradle:0.6.+'

}

}

apply plugin: 'android-library'

repositories {

mavenCentral()

}

android {

compileSdkVersion 18

buildToolsVersion "17.0.0"

defaultConfig {

minSdkVersion 14

targetSdkVersion 18

}

sourceSets {

main {

manifest.srcFile 'AndroidManifest.xml'

java.srcDirs = ['src']

resources.srcDirs = ['src']

aidl.srcDirs = ['src']

renderscript.srcDirs = ['src']

}

}

}

dependencies {

compile 'com.android.support:appcompat-v7:+'

compile files('libs/gson-2.2.4.jar')

}

这是后编译还会有可能报错

这时候可能需要修改一下Httpzoid目录下的AndroidManifest.xml文件有可能存在和你项目中文件有冲突或版本跨度太大导致语法的错误修改一下,做完以上几步android studio就可以导入第三方类库。


‘捌’ android读取excel文件第三方类库都有哪些

目前应用比较多的处理Excel的类库主要有两种JXL 和POI。
都是开源项目,POI是apache下的子项目,经过研究和比较觉得POI更新更快一些。
到目前为止已经支持Excel2007版本了,不过目前也是3.5的beta4版以上才支持。JXL貌似还不行,但是个人觉得在使用上JXL简单一些。
另外JXL还有一个小问题需要注意一下在读取Excel文件是单次读不可以超过10000行,否则会溢出。经过试验9999可以,10000就不行了,不知道jxl为什么要控制在这个数。
因此如果兄弟们需要单次读取大数据量的时候需要手工处理下,分次读取就可以了。
因此建议处理EXCEL97-2003时可选用JXL,处理2007版本可选择POI,

各种用法四处都有这里只贴上JXL读取Excel97-03和POI读取Excel2007的代码:

public List<FSNInfo> readExcel07(String filepath) throws IOException{
List<Info> fsnList = new ArrayList<Info>(10);
//取得excel
XSSFWorkbook xwb = new XSSFWorkbook(filepath);
//取得Excel的第一个sheet;
XSSFSheet sheet = xwb.getSheetAt(0);
XSSFRow row;
//遍历sheet的所有行,前两个单元格,设置为Info的属性,放入ArrayList返回
for (int i = sheet.getFirstRowNum(); i < sheet.getPhysicalNumberOfRows(); i++) {
Info fsn;
row = sheet.getRow(i);
fsn.set1(row.getCell(0).toString());
fsn.set2(row.getCell(1).toString());
fsnList.add(fsn);
}
return fsnList;
}


public List<Info> readExcelSubRecord(int start,int len) {
if(wb == null)
return null;
List<Info> list = new ArrayList<Info>(10);
try {
Workbook book = wb;
Sheet se = book.getSheet(0);
int rownum = start+len;
for (int i = start; i < rownum; i++) {

Info fsn;
fsn.set1(se.getCell(0, i).getContents());
fsn.set2(se.getCell(1, i).getContents());
list.add(fsn);
}
book.close();
} catch (Exception e) {
logger.error("Parse excel97-2003 error: "+e);
return null;
}
return list;
}

热点内容
诺基亚密码忘了打什么电话 发布:2024-09-17 03:27:09 浏览:555
树深度优先算法 发布:2024-09-17 03:26:58 浏览:472
跳转页源码 发布:2024-09-17 03:13:05 浏览:543
html文件上传表单 发布:2024-09-17 03:08:02 浏览:785
聊天软件编程 发布:2024-09-17 03:00:07 浏览:726
linuxoracle安装路径 发布:2024-09-17 01:57:29 浏览:688
两个安卓手机照片怎么同步 发布:2024-09-17 01:51:53 浏览:207
cf编译后没有黑框跳出来 发布:2024-09-17 01:46:54 浏览:249
安卓怎么禁用应用读取列表 发布:2024-09-17 01:46:45 浏览:524
win10设密码在哪里 发布:2024-09-17 01:33:32 浏览:662